This year's Pride parade starts from Baker Street at 1pm, heading along Oxford Street, down Regent Street and ending in Trafalgar Square. This year's theme is 'Come Out And Play'. The parade ends with a gathering in Trafalgar Square, with speakers and entertainers from 3pm. Plus there'll be entertainment in Soho with various gay venues hosting their own sound stages. The Women's stage will feature Jess Gardham, MC Angel, Sandra D and more. The Urban Stage will feature Denise Pearson from 5 Star and many others. The Ku Bar Pop Stage will feature the first appearance by Boy George since his recent spell in jail.
